Nogalious is a retro themed adventure game harking back to games like Wonder Boy in Monster Land and Dizzy. Part of a planned trilogy the game's design, music and graphics has been lovingly done so that it looks and sounds like it was made in the late 80s and early 90s.
The story follows Nogalious on his quest to rescue his kidnapped daughter from the evil Darama. Gameplay is a mixture of platforming, combat and puzzles, with you having to adventure through five different level. Much like games of old it has a limited credit system and once you lose your last life it's back to the start of the game to try again.
